Chemical hair straightening: pros and cons
Chemical hair straightening: pros and cons

Long and luxurious hair is the real pride of girls. Usually, the owners of straight curls try to curl them, and curly or wavy ones - to straighten them. And to achieve the result, they often resort to chemical action on the hair. Location: Location: Today on sale you can find special devices - hair straightening tongs, called in everyday life "irons". With their help, hair can be straightened at home, but this effect does not last long, and the procedure has to be repeated every day, and it takes a lot of time. At the same time, straightening with forceps negatively affects the structure of the curls, because of which the hairstyle loses its flawless and healthy appearance.

To solve the problem, you can use chemical straightening. During this procedure, the curls are treated with a special compound containing either sodium hydroxide or ammonium thioglycolate. Penetrating deep into the hair structure, the product makes them smoother, softer and smoother.

Despite the fact that beauty salons use chemical compositions that are saturated with various extracts and useful substances, this mixture still has a rather aggressive effect. Outwardly, the hairstyle looks great, but the damage caused by the chemical straightening procedure will be only slightly less than from ironing.

Due to chemical straightening, the hair becomes dry, so it is not recommended to resort to it for those who like dyeing, bleaching or highlighting. The procedure is categorically contraindicated for those who do a perm. If you don't like the result of straightening, it is better to wait a while until the curls recover from the impact on their structure.

The chemical hair straightening procedure has some advantages. Firstly, you will no longer need a straightener, as well as use a hairdryer to style them: the hair will look perfect anyway. Secondly, you are guaranteed a long-lasting result, since only the growing hair roots will require renewal. Finally, due to the fact that you do not use the hairdryer for a long time, the hair structure will be restored, brittleness will decrease, split ends will less often spoil the look of the hairstyle.
